Demographics - Wolfe City, TX

Wolfe City has a population of 1,399 residents, offering a diverse community with a median age of nearly 38 and a balanced gender ratio. The area features a strong blend of backgrounds, with about 75% White, 10% Black, and % Asian residents, and over 10% speaking a language other than English at home. Its high population density contributes to a lively suburban atmosphere.

Weather

What is the weather like in Wolfe City, TX year-round?

Wolfe City experiences four distinct seasons, with warm summers reaching highs of 95°F and cold winters dipping to 33°F. The area receives about 42 inches of rainfall annually and enjoys sunshine on 62% of days. This climate offers residents a balanced mix of outdoor opportunities year-round.

How are the schools in Wolfe City, TX?

Wolfe City offers quality education options, with public schools like Wolfe City Elementary School and Wolfe City High School known for favorable student-to-teacher ratios. Families also have access to private schools and several nearby colleges, including Texas A&M University-Commerce. The community is committed to educational excellence for all age groups.

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in Wolfe City, TX?

The local housing market is strong, with a median home price of $108,000 and an owner-occupied rate of nearly 65%. The market has seen a 4.2% appreciation over the past year, and rental vacancy rates remain moderate at 9.8%. Wolfe City offers a mix of stability and opportunity for both buyers and renters.
